Subhash Chandra Bose Aapda Prabandhan Puraskar

The Gujarat Institute of Disaster Management (GIDM) as well as Sikkim State Disaster Management Authority’s Vice Chairman Vinod Sharma received the “Subhas Chandra Bose Aapda Prabandhan Puraskar 2022”.

Key Points

  • Both were presented award for their excellent work in disaster management.
  • GIDM was selected in the Institutional category while, Vinod Sharma was named in individual category.
  • They received the award, along with the awardees of 2019, 2020 and 2021.

Who will present the award?

Award was presented by Prime Minister Narendra Modi in the investiture ceremony, which was held on January 23, 2022 to commemorate the 125th birth anniversary of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ose.

Subhas Chandra Bose Aapda Prabandhan Puraskar

This is an annual award, instituted by central government. The award recognises and honour the invaluable contribution and selfless service rendered by organisations and individuals in India in the field of disaster management. Award is announced on January 23, every year, on the occasion of birth anniversary of freedom fighter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ose. In case of an institution, the award comprises of a cash prize of Rs 51 lakh as well a certificate while in case of an individual, it contains Rs 5 lakh and a certificate.

Nomination for the award

For the award in 2022, the nominations were started from July 1, 2021 onwards. 243 valid nominations were received this year, from institutions and individuals.

Why was GIDM selected?

The GIDM was established in 2012. Since its establishment, the institution has been working to enhance the disaster risk reduction (DRR) capacity in Gujarat. Under strategically designed capacity building programs, GIDM has trained about 12,000 professionals on diverse issues related to multi-hazard risk management and reduction during the pandemic. Some recent initiatives by GIDM include- development of a “user-friendly Gujarat Fire Safety Compliance Portal” and “Mobile App Technology based Advanced Covid-19 Syndromic Surveillance (ACSyS) system”. ACSyS system was developed to complement Covid-19 surveillance efforts.

Why was Vinay Sharma selected?

Vinay Sharma is a senior professor at Indian Institute of Public Administration and vice-chairman of Sikkim State Disaster Management Authority. He was the founder coordinator of the National Centre of Disaster Management, which is now known as National Institute of Disaster Management. He worked for bringing disaster risk reduction (DRR) to the forefront of national agenda, which gave him international recognition. He is a resource person to Lal Bahadur Shastri National Academy of Administration (LBSNAA) as well as all Administrative Training Institutes (ATIs) for disaster management.
